Transaction 28530729aed079431f51be42109233e38b6fc916e5ee7521e8e7aa7c96e6ac84
1 Input
1 Output
-
28530729aed079431f51be42109233e38b6fc916e5ee7521e8e7aa7c96e6ac84:0
- value
- 209500
- script pubkey
- OP_0 OP_PUSHBYTES_20 102a03ec76e99fa52f54d57c1c8630d082f5ba14
- address
- bc1qzq4q8mrkax062t65647pep3s6zp0tws5qvvpx9